Calculating the Required Ladder Height

To determine the necessary ladder height, consider the height you need to reach and add about 3 feet to ensure the top rung is not the standing point. For a 16-foot reach, you would ideally need a ladder with a height of at least 19 feet. This calculation is general and may vary depending on the ladder type and the user’s height. It’s crucial to choose a ladder that allows you to maintain three points of contact (two hands and one foot, or two feet and one hand) at all times.

Ladder Materials and Weight Capacities

Ladders come in various materials, including aluminum, fiberglass, and wood. Each material has its advantages and disadvantages. Fiberglass ladders are excellent for electrical work due to their non-conductive properties, while aluminum ladders are lightweight and corrosion-resistant. The weight capacity of the ladder is also crucial, as it must support the user’s weight plus any tools or materials being used. Always check the weight capacity and ensure it exceeds your requirements.

Rung Spacing and Special Features

Rung spacing is an essential factor for safety and comfort. Ladders with closer rung spacing can be more comfortable to climb but may be heavier. Special features such as levelers or standoff arms can enhance safety and stability, especially on uneven surfaces or when working near walls.

How often should I inspect my ladder to ensure it remains safe for use to reach 16 feet?

Regular inspection of a ladder is crucial to ensure it remains safe for use and can continue to provide reliable access to 16 feet. The frequency of inspection will depend on the ladder’s usage and environment, but as a general rule, ladders should be inspected before each use, as well as on a regular scheduled basis (e.g., monthly or quarterly). During inspection, users should check for signs of wear or damage, such as rust, corrosion, or cracks in the material. They should also verify that all rungs, steps, and other components are secure and functioning properly.

In addition to regular inspections, users should also be aware of any changes in the ladder’s condition or performance that may indicate a need for maintenance or repair. For example, if the ladder becomes more difficult to climb or appears unstable, it may be necessary to inspect it more frequently or take it out of service until repairs can be made.
